1) Improper input validation (CVE-ID: CVE-2026-72304)

CWE-ID: CWE-20 - Improper input validation

CVSSv4: 6.8 [CVSS:4.0/AV:L/AC:L/AT:N/PR:L/UI:N/VC:N/VI:N/VA:H/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N]


The vulnerability allows a local user to cause a denial of service.

The vulnerability exists due to improper input validation in sof_ipc4_bytes_put when processing user-supplied control data. A local user can provide crafted control data with a mismatched size field to cause a denial of service.

The copy length is derived from the previously stored buffer header rather than the incoming header, which can result in truncated data or stale bytes being copied.
